De igual forma permite detectar la presencia de bacterias en muestras de sangre a partir del análisis del hemocultivo y analizar la calidad microbiológica de muestras de agua, leche, productos lácteos, carne y sus derivados, etc. La contaminación microbiológica constituye un importante indicador de calidad utilizado en el sector industrial mientras que en el ambiente clínico desempeña un papel determinante en el diagnóstico de enfermedades.This invention is related to the branch of microbiology and food hygiene and constitutes a system for the rapid evaluation of the state of microbiological contamination of different biological samples. The invention is related to the design of a system that allows photostimulation of photosynthetic and non-photosynthetic microorganisms present in a solid or liquid culture medium. In the case of photostimulation of a biological sample in liquid medium, changes in turbidity and / or bioimpedance originating in the culture medium are recorded by said growth, which allows to detect urinary tract infections from direct urine samples including the simultaneous identification of E. Coli. It is also useful for the determination of the antibiogram from isolated colonies or positive samples that are obtained directly from the sources that contain them. Likewise, it allows detecting the presence of bacteria in blood samples from the blood culture analysis and analyzing the microbiological quality of samples of water, milk, dairy products, meat and its derivatives, etc. Microbiological contamination is an important indicator of quality used in the industrial sector while in the clinical environment it plays a decisive role in the diagnosis of diseases.
